FYT Positive Image Campaign

Posted: 09/10/2006, 10:05

Several agencies, including FYT, have come together to look at creative ways to question and challenge negative stereotypes about young people in the media. We are fed up with the generalisations and worried that these kinds of labels run the risk of becoming self fulfilling prophesies. We are also aware, from research by the Young Christian Workers, that this is an issue that many young people are also concerned about.

One of the campaigns we plan is to use a large public space to create an art installation with young people - based upon a pyramid - representing maslows hierarchy of need - which underlines our common humanity - young - old, black - white - male - female etc... (the dimensions of this structure will be in the region of 20 foot in height etc!). Alongside this we are conducting research into how adult opinions of young people are formed - we plan to launch the research alongside the installation - we hope that the PR from the pyramid will act as a 'pull' for media interest.
